Question:
Consider the hyperbola x^2/100 - y^2/64 = 1 with foci at S and S1, where S lies on the positive x-axis. Let P be a point on the hyperbola in the first quadrant, SPS1 = α less π/2. The straight line through S having the same slope as the tangent at P intersects the straight line S1P at P1. Let δ be the distance of P from the straight line SP1, and β = S1P. The greatest integer less than or equal to (βδ / 9) * sin(α / 2) is _______.
